Can't locate camera to import

having trouble connecting my canon gl2 so that i can import video.

You do not give nearly enough information... how is the camera connected? Does it show as an option in the import window?
This seems to be a DV camera. My guess is that you may be trying to connect it via USB.
You need to connect it via Firewire for transferring video. USB in these cameras only works for transferring still images.

  • Can't locate imported iPhoto files in Finder

    I recently imported a series of pictures into iPhoto. However I can't locate these picture files on Finder..What happened was I had to fire up iPhoto app each time and right click to 'Show File'. It said the path was user/Pictures/iPhoto Library/Originals/2007/...
    I want to locate these files on Finder, however, when I clicked on user directory user/Pictures/iPhoto Library I can't drill down further. It seems that 'Originals' folder is missing. When I show package contents though, this folder showed up. This is a frustrating experience for me because I can't upload the pictures to the web, or easily find them.
    Does anyone has any idea if this is normal behavior or is there a way I can easily access the list of pictures I've imported without firing up the iPhoto? Appreciate any response. Thanks very much.

    spirlie
    Welcome to the Apple Discussions.
    Does anyone has any idea if this is normal behavior or is there a way I can easily access the list of pictures I've imported without firing up the iPhoto
    This is perfectly normal behaviour for v7 of iPhoto. The change was made to the format of the iPhoto library because many users were inadvertently corrupting their library by browsing through it with other software or making changes in it themselves. If you're willing to risk database corruption, you can restore the older functionality simply by right clicking on the iPhoto Library and choosing 'Show Package Contents'. Then simply make an alias to the folders you require and put that alias on the desktop or where ever you want it. Be aware though, that this is a hack and not supported by Apple.

    There are three ways (at least) to get files from the iPhoto Window.
    1. *Drag and Drop*: Drag a photo from the iPhoto Window to the desktop, there iPhoto will make a full-sized copy of the pic.
    2. *File -> Export*: Select the files in the iPhoto Window and go File -> Export. The dialogue will give you various options, including altering the format, naming the files and changing the size. Again, producing a copy.
    3. *Show File*: Right- (or Control-) Click on a pic and in the resulting dialogue choose 'Show File'. A Finder window will pop open with the file already selected.
    To upload to MySpace or any site that does not have an iPhoto Export Plug-in the recommended way is to Select the Pic in the iPhoto Window and go File -> Export and export the pic to the desktop, then upload from there. After the upload you can trash the pic on the desktop. It's only a copy and your original is safe in iPhoto.

  • How can i get final cut see my camera to import video?

    my final cut is not seeing my camera to import video? help me?

    First, with the camera connected via firewire to your mac, go to applications:  utilities:  system profiler and make sure the firewire is showing the camera.   If not, it's possible the firewire port is burned out on the camera or on the computer.  You can also try swatting out  the firewire cable. 
    HDV is always a little tricky.  Make sure your easy setup matches your shooting format.  If I remember correctly, the camera may shoot some formats that are not compatible with capturing in fcp.  You can usually display the shooting format in the cameras lcd format.  Let us know what it is.
    When you've matched the fcp easy setup to the format you've shot,  quit final cut, start the camera playing with a video signal, and then launch fcp and start log and capture and see if the camera is recognized and if there's video in the log and capture  window.
